    Chris Wood's Premier League goal-scoring form has continued


    The All Whites striker has nabbed his fifth goal of the season, helping Nottingham Forest to a 1-nil win over Crystal Palace.

    He's explained what's been described as a "baby" celebration, sliding the ball under his shirt after the strike from 22 metres out.



    The victory is Forest's third of the season, lifting them to eighth on the ladder.
